About Brian Tegtmeyer, CFP®
Hi, I’m Brian Tegtmeyer, CFP®, a flat-fee financial advisor based in Dublin, Ohio. I specialize in tax-smart planning for new retirees who want to make the most of the first 10 years of retirement, without compromising the rest.The first years of retirement are often your healthiest and most active, but they’re also when the biggest financial decisions happen: Social Security timing, Medicare enrollment, withdrawal strategies, Roth conversions, and more. The choices you make now will shape the rest of your retirement.
With over 15 years of experience as a financial advisor, I’ve dedicated my career to helping new retirees make confident, tax-smart decisions during this pivotal window.

About Truly Prosper Financial Planning
At Truly Prosper Financial Planning, our True Wealth financial planning process includes 5 stages designed to help you retire with clarity and confidence.1️⃣ Stage 1: Explore. We learn about your needs, concerns, and aspirations and explain how our flat fee financial planning services can help meet those specific needs. Then we decide if we have a good fit to work together.
2️⃣ Stage 2: Engage. Once we agree to work together, we focus on identifying and clarifying your true values and priorities. This process helps us understand your unique frame of reference and forms the foundation of your financial plan.
3️⃣ Stage 3: Envision. We guide you in creating a vision for the future that is compelling, fulfilling, and inspiring. We also establish guidelines for developing a financial plan that aligns with your values and priorities.
4️⃣ Stage 4: Enlighten. We present our financial planning recommendations and demonstrate how they support the life you want to live. We also summarize and clarify insights and knowledge about your values, priorities, concerns, transitions, goals, and objectives.
5️⃣ Stage 5: Empower. This stage is the most important part of the process; putting the plan into action. This involves implementing the current recommendations and updating your financial plan as your goals and circumstances change.
We believe our life-centered planning approach leads to greater success and fulfillment in retirement.

Tips for Writing a Helpful Review
Be descriptive. Instead of just saying what you like or dislike, share why. What have you enjoyed most or least about your experience with the provider? Have they helped you overcome a difficult financial challenge or strengthened your knowledge about particular money matters? The more details, the better!
Be honest. Your rating and review should reflect your actual experience.
Stay relevant. Ensure your review is helpful to others by avoiding off-topic discussions or personal opinions not relevant to your direct experience.
Make your review easy to read. Reviews should be readable to others. Use proper grammar, avoid excessive capitalization or punctuation, and be sure to check your spelling.
Be yourself. Don’t post as, or pretend to be, someone else, and do not say you’re associated with a person or organization with which you are not.
Be nice. Don’t write abusive, hateful, threatening, or harassing content. Avoid personal threats, hate speech, obscenities, or inflammatory language.
Respect the privacy of others. Don’t post information that can be used to identify another individual or compromise their privacy.
